Highest time F-16 departures Luke
Senior Airman Troy Anderson and Airman 1st Class Jacob Hefly, 56th Equipment Maintenance Squadron aircraft structural maintenance technicians, remove tape and plastic from aircraft 178 after painting on Jan. 29. Aircraft 178, which has the most flying hours of all aircraft at Luke, had sections repainted before being transferred to the 162nd Fighter Wing in Tucson. (U.S. Air Force photo/Staff Sgt. Ian Dean)
